Greetings, everyone! The Atlanta Hawks improved exponentially on Monday evening, but it was not quite enough to secure a streak-busting victory. Episode 88 of the Locked on Hawks podcast is here to break down the action and topics for the show include the following:
- The Russell Westbrook show
- Another less than optimal performance from Kent Bazemore
- It is nice when the Hawks have Paul Millsap
- There was a change in the starting lineup and it generated some thoughts
- A theory on why said lineup change occurred instead of another option
- Offensive issues against OKC and what was a strong showing, despite Westbrook’s numbers, on the defensive end
- Much, much more
